Contents of the Find Code Dialog Box
Use the fields and options to configure the Find Code dialog box.

| Field | Description |
|---|---|
| Find in ID |
Selecting this option tells Open Plan to look for a code with the ID you enter in the input box. |
| Find in Description |
Selecting this option tells Open Plan to look for a code with the description you enter in the input box. When you select this option, Open Plan enables the following fields that allow you to customize the search.
|
| Match Case |
Selecting this option tells Open Plan to look for a code containing a description that matches both the text and capitalization that you entered in the input box. | Find Whole Word |
Selecting this option tells Open Plan to look for a code containing the same whole words in the description that you entered in the input box. For example, Open Plan would not find a code with "Pharmacy Systems" in the description if you entered "Pharmacy System" in the input box. Similarly, Open Plan would not find a code with "Pharmacy System" in the description if you entered "Pharmacy Systems" in the input box. |
| Find |
Clicking this button initiates the search with the parameters you enter in the Find Code dialog box. When Open Plan locates the code, it is highlighted in the Select Code dialog box. |
| Cancel |
Clicking this button closes the Find Code dialog box without searching for a code. |
